From a Unity forum post i found

You have to realize that what Unity does, which IS special, is to lower the entry-bar to game programming. It provides a layer of abstraction that wraps the university-level stuff in cotton so well, that thousands of hopeful young people become interested enough, and encouraged enough, to try out programming. If you're a beginner, it's way easier to understand what's going on in a 3D coordinate system when you can rotate and move your objects in an editor instead of hitting your head against a brick wall every time you forget to wrap your transformations in calls to glPushMatrix and glPopMatrix, and your world gets completely fucked up because of it. What Unity does is bring graphics to the masses,
